Alelo, a market-leading company specializing in benefits, corporate expense management, and incentives, joins forces with Lucy, an AI-powered marketing automation platform, to announce a strategic partnership. This involves offering a digital marketing platform specifically designed for SMEs across all sectors in the country. The collaboration aims to democratize access to digital marketing by providing a tool that simplifies and automates the creation of campaigns and marketing materials. As a result, small businesses can attract more customers and increase sales, even without deep advertising knowledge.
Through this initiative, entrepreneurs or administrators will be able to develop high-performance marketing strategies in a simplified manner and create digital communication materials to support this promotion, such as posts, ads, websites, menus, and other content. The expectation is to boost the businesses of Alelo’s clients, which currently serves over 150,000 corporate clients and 1 million commercial establishments.
